The Petitioners in these Writ Petitions are Primary Agricultural Co-operative Credit Societies functioning across the State of Tamil Nadu and they are aggrieved by the enforcement of Section 194-N of the Income Tax Act, 1961 (hereinafter referred to as 'the Act' for short), by which tax has been imposed for withdrawal of payments above Rs. 1,00,00,000/- by them. 3. It has been brought to notice that the then Hon'ble Chief Minister of Tamil Nadu in the letter dated 24.03.2020 addressed to the Hon'ble Minister for Finance, Government of India has stated as follows:- 10/19 https://www.mhc.tn.gov.in/judis W.P. (MD) Nos. 4499, 4536 and 4592 of 2023 “I would like to inform that the Government of India in its Finance Bill 2019 has introduced a new section, Section 194-N, in the Income Tax Act, 1961, under which 2% has to be deducted by the payer as Tax Deduction at Source (TDS) when the aggregate amount of cash withdrawal by an account holder from one or more of his bank accounts exceed rupees one crore. The 2% TDS will be deducted on the amount of cash withdrawal exceeding one crore. In Tamil Nadu, Cooperative Societies are functioning under a three tie structure at Village, Taluk and District level, with State Apex Cooperative Bank at its top. Primary Agricultural Cooperative Credit Society (PACCS) at the Village level withdraw cash from their Savings Bank Account in the District Central Cooperative Bank (DCCB) and issue loans to farmers and members. Since the loans to PACCS are issued as cash credit, the repayment made by PACCS into their cash credit account is again drawn through their Savings Bank Account to issue loan to farmers or members. The difference between the interest paid by the PACCS borrowing from DCCBs and the interest collected from farmers or members on the loans issued 11/19 https://www.mhc.tn.gov.in/judis W.P. (MD) Nos. 4499, 4536 and 4592 of 2023 to them, is the only source of income for PACCS. This interest spread between borrowing and lending is the interest margin available for PACCS for their financial credibility and survival. Deduction of 2% as TDS, for the cash drawls exceeding one crore by PACCS from DCCBs will not only erode the interest spread available to them further, but will also erode the income it had earned. Furthermore, the interest margin available to PACCS will be realized only on repayment of loan by farmers, but TDS of 2% will have to be deducted even before the loans are issued by PACCS. This will create a cash crunch for PACCS for its lending to farmers, apart from eating all their income. The Ministry of Finance, Department of Revenue, vide its Central Board of Direct Taxes Notification 70/2019/F No. 370142/12/2019-TPL (part 1) dated 20.09.2019 has exempted the commission agent or trader operating under Agriculture Produce Market Committee and registered under any law relating to Agriculture Produce Market Committee of the State with effect from 01.09.2019 from the provisions of Section 194-N of the Income Tax Act. 12/19 https://www.mhc.tn.gov.in/judis W.P. (MD) Nos. 4499, 4536 and 4592 of 2023 If similar exemption to Section 194-N of Income Tax Act is not provided to PACCS and other Primary Cooperative Societies for their cash withdrawal exceeding rupees one crore from their accounts in the District Central Cooperative Bank, credit delivery to farmers through PACCS will be crippled and their activities will come to a halt because of the negative margin in their lending operations to farmers. In view of the position stated above, I request you to kindly consider granting exemption to the PACCS and other Primary Cooperative Societies from the provisions of Section 194-N of the Income Tax Act, 1961, as it is detrimental to the interest of the PACCS in the State which serve the farmers.” The said request made has been followed by another letter in D.O. Lr No. 15350/CC1/2022 dated 27.09.2022 from the Chief Secretary, Government of Tamil Nadu, Chennai to the Secretary to Government of India, Finance Department, New Delhi and the Chairperson, Central Board of Direct Taxes, New Delhi seeking to accord exemption to the Primary Agricultural Co- operative Credit Societies and other Primary Co-operative Societies from the provisions of Section 194-N of the Act. 13/19 https://www.mhc.tn.gov.in/judis W.P. It is submitted by Learned Counsel for the Petitioners that without even considering the said representation made by the Government of Tamil Nadu, the authorities of the Income Tax Department of the Central Government are taking coercive action against the Primary Agricultural Co-operative Credit Societies, like the Petitioners in these cases, by deduction of tax at source under the guise of implementing Section 194-N of the Act, which is causing grave financial hardship in carrying on their business transactions with their customers, who are farmers and mostly belong to the lower strata of the society. In that backdrop, these Writ Petitions have been filed seeking direction to the Central Government to consider the representation in D.O. Lr No. 15350/CC1/2022 dated 27.09.2022 sent by the Chief Secretary, Government of Tamil Nadu to the Chairperson, Central Board of Direct Taxes and the Ministry of Finance, Government of India to accord exemption to the Primary Agricultural Co- operative Credit Societies in the State of Tamil Nadu from the provisions of Section 194-N of the Act and to consequently restrain the concerned authorities from taking any coercive steps for recovery of tax deduction at source of payments made by the District Central Co-operative Banks to the Primary Agricultural Co-operative Cr edit Societies in that regard. 14/19 https://www.mhc.tn.gov.in/judis W.P. (MD) Nos. 4499, 4536 and 4592 of 2023 5. Having regard to the aforesaid submissions made, this Court without expressing any view on the merits of the controversy involved, passes the following order:- (i) it shall be incumbent upon the Ministry of Finance, Government of India and the Central Board of Direct Taxes, New Delhi to immediately examine the representation in D.O. Lr No. 15350/CC1/2022 dated 27.09.2022 sent by the Chief Secretary, Government of Tamil Nadu; (ii) if it is found that any other details or supporting documents are necessary for granting the relief claimed had not been produced, the deficiencies in that regard shall be informed in writing to the concerned persons requiring the same to be furnished within a time frame of not less than 15 clear working days for the same; (iii) in the event of not being satisfied with the said requirements even thereafter, an enquiry shall be conducted affording full opportunity of hearing to the Government of Tamil Nadu and to all stakeholders through public notice to explain their views in that regard; (iv) a reasoned order shall be passed dealing with each of the contentions raised on merits and in accordance with law and the decision taken communicated to the Government of Tamil Nadu in writing under 15/19 https://www.mhc.tn.gov.in/judis W.P. (MD) Nos. 4499, 4536 and 4592 of 2023 acknowledgment; and (v) the authorities under the Act shall be restrained from taking any coercive action for recovery of tax deduction at source under Section 194-N of the Act from the Primary Agricultural Co-operative Credit Societies in the State of Tamil Nadu till the aforesaid exercise is completed. In the upshot, these Writ Petitions are ordered on the aforesaid terms. Consequently, the connected Miscellaneous Petitions are closed.
